Plot.
Roberto, a 10-year-old boy, is drawn to music. An old organist discovers his gifts, and begins his musical education which will lead him to the head of an orchestra.

Wiki.
Prelude to Glory (French: Prélude à la gloire) is a 1950 French drama film directed by Georges Lacombe and starring Roberto Benzi, Paul Bernard and Jean Debucourt. It was shot at the Neuilly Studios in Paris. The film's sets were designed by the art directors Eugène Delfau and Henri Morin. A British film Prelude to Fame with a very similar theme was released the same year.
